The image captures a cultural performance, likely a traditional dance or parade, in Salatiga, Indonesia. In the foreground, several individuals are dressed in colorful, ornate costumes. They are adorned with purple and white headwraps, and some have elaborate makeup, including red accents on their cheeks. Many are holding or standing behind large, shield-like props decorated with vibrant paintings of what appear to be stylized horses or mythical creatures, featuring yellow, green, and red motifs. Black feather-like adornments add to the dramatic visual effect. Behind the performers, a backdrop features a detailed mural. The mural depicts a relief-style artwork, showing figures with strong facial features, one holding a staff. Further back in the mural, there's a depiction of an elephant. Above the mural, a decorative banner with ornate patterns in red and gold is visible, bearing text that reads "KLASEMAN SALATIGA". This banner suggests the event is associated with the Klasean area of Salatiga. To the right of the performers and behind them, a dense display of peacock feathers creates a rich, iridescent backdrop, further enhancing the festive and traditional atmosphere of the scene. The lighting appears to be natural, suggesting an outdoor event during the day. The overall impression is one of a vibrant cultural celebration, deeply rooted in local tradition.
